Why is the molecular mass of water 18?

Well, a particular water molecule consists of two hydrogen atoms and one oxygen atom. The atomic mass of the hydrogen atom is 1 atomic mass unit (amu) whereas the atomic mass of 1 atom of oxygen is 16 amu. Therefore, the total molecular weight of the water molecule is 16 + 2 x 1 = 18 atomic mass unit.

What is the meaning of saying molecular mass of water is 18 amu?

The sum of the atomic masses of all atoms in a molecule, based on a scale in which the atomic masses of hydrogen, carbon, nitrogen, and oxygen are 1, 12, 14, and 16, respectively. For example, the molecular mass of water, which has two atoms of hydrogen and one atom of oxygen, is 18 (i.e., 2 + 16).
